Biography
Kevin Vaughan is a Republican state representative serving Tennessee's 95th House District, based in Collierville in the Memphis suburbs, since 2017. Born on April 30, 1962, he is an engineer, real estate developer, and broker who is married with two children and a Baptist.
Education and Political Experience
- Education: Earned a B.S. in Electrical Engineering from Memphis State University in 1984.
- Political Experience: Elected overwhelmingly to his first full term in 2018 against Democrat Sanjeev Memula; currently serves as Chairman of the Commerce Committee and holds positions on the Banking & Consumer Affairs Subcommittee, Business & Utilities Subcommittee, Calendar & Rules Committee, and Finance, Ways, and Means Committee.
